Abstract

PURPOSE:To enable automatic setting and operation based on input of name of articles by storing in advance, as a table, each set quantity about production necessary for operation of a production apparatus and reference values about inspection, reading each set variable corresponding to article to be produced to set it automatically. CONSTITUTION:A step S11 is an input process of code, quantity, etc., of production articles, whereby, for example, they are inputted into a computer using an input device such as a key board. A step S12 reads a set value table corresponding to inputted code of articles. In said table, mixing ratio, optimum water content, optimum operation pattern, etc., corresponding to address of article code are stored so that production instructions are given to a batcher plant and also kind of articles and production quantity program are given to a molding machine. A step S13 is a read process of an inspection table for article code. In the inspection table, limit values, e.g. thickness or weight of blocks when products are blocks, corresponding to address of article code are stored to give instructions to an inspection means in the line.

The conventional method will be explained with reference to FIG. First, step 3
In step 21, various setting values are set depending on the product type and quantity to be manufactured. That is, in step 822, after setting the various setting values, the mixing ratio of raw materials is set according to the product, the I & suitable ice water content is set, the kneading pattern is set, and the limit values for product inspection are set. Operate the line and start production. In step 823, the finished product is inspected, and in step S24, the inspection result is determined. If the inspection result is OK, the process moves to Stella 1 S25 to determine whether the set quantity has been reached, and if it is less than the quantity, step S22
Go back and repeat the above operation. If the inspection result is not OK in step 324, the process moves to step 326 and the product is discharged, and each set value is changed in step 327 to prevent defects.

(Problems to be Solved by the Invention) According to the conventional method described above, when setting the product type and quantity, each time, the mixing ratio of raw materials, the moisture content, the crosstalk pattern, and the limit value for inspection are set. Regarding etc.
Settings must be reconfigured for each product type due to the human system, and these tasks require a high degree of skill, and the work itself is complicated, resulting in many defects before finding the optimal setting values. there were.

In FIG. 1, step 511 is a process of inputting the product code, quantity, etc., to the machine using an input device such as a keyboard. Step S12 is a process of reading a setting value table according to the input type code. In addition, a setting value table (not shown) includes the mixing ratio of materials, i&appropriate moisture, etc. according to the address of the product code.
Al! 1 operation pattern, etc. are stored, and the batcher
In addition to giving production instructions to the plant, it also instructs the molding machine about the product type and planned production quantity.

Step S13 is a process of reading an inspection table according to the product type code. An inspection table (not shown) stores limit values according to the address of the product code, for example, if the product is a block, the thickness of the block, 1 weight, etc., and gives instructions to the inspection means on the line. The processing in steps 814 to 519 is the same as the processing shown in FIG. 2, and will therefore be omitted.
